pub struct PersistentSubscriptionSettings<A> {
Show 13 fields pub resolve_link_tos: bool, pub start_from: StreamPosition<A>, pub extra_statistics: bool, pub message_timeout: Duration, pub max_retry_count: i32, pub live_buffer_size: i32, pub read_batch_size: i32, pub history_buffer_size: i32, pub checkpoint_after: Duration, pub checkpoint_lower_bound: i32, pub checkpoint_upper_bound: i32, pub max_subscriber_count: i32, pub consumer_strategy_name: SystemConsumerStrategy,
}
Expand description

Gathers every persistent subscription property.

Fields§

§resolve_link_tos: bool

Whether or not the persistent subscription should resolve link events to their linked events.

§start_from: StreamPosition<A>

Where the subscription should start from (event number).

§extra_statistics: bool

Whether or not in depth latency statistics should be tracked on this subscription.

§message_timeout: Duration

The amount of time after which a message should be considered to be timeout and retried.

§max_retry_count: i32

The maximum number of retries (due to timeout) before a message get considered to be parked.

§live_buffer_size: i32

The size of the buffer listening to live messages as they happen.

§read_batch_size: i32

The number of events read at a time when paging in history.

§history_buffer_size: i32

The number of events to cache when paging through history.

§checkpoint_after: Duration

The amount of time to try checkpoint after.

§checkpoint_lower_bound: i32

The minimum number of messages to checkpoint.

§checkpoint_upper_bound: i32

The maximum number of messages to checkpoint. If this number is reached , a checkpoint will be forced.

§max_subscriber_count: i32

The maximum number of subscribers allowed.

§consumer_strategy_name: SystemConsumerStrategy

The strategy to use for distributing events to client consumers.
